Green Deal Home Improvement Fund now open

Today (9 June) the Government has launched its Green Deal Home Improvement Fund (GDHIF).

The new incentive scheme is open to all householders in England and Wales wishing to improve the energy efficiency of their homes. It allows householders to choose one or both of two core offers available and they may also be eligible to claim up to £7,600 as a bundled package.

Under the scheme measures can be installed by Green Deal authorised Installers and Providers registered with the GDHIF.

Simon Cross, commercial director at biomass distribution company IXUS Energy, said: “We welcome the Government’s announcement of further support for energy efficiency measures to help householders reduce their energy bills.

“Although it won’t directly assist customers with biomass boiler installations, the marketing campaign to publicise it will hopefully help to raise awareness of other government schemes designed to assist with carbon-reduction and cost savings for consumers – schemes like the domestic Renewable Heat Incentive (RHI).

“The domestic RHI is designed to repay the cost of installing a biomass boiler over seven years, and as such is the most generous scheme of its kind in the world yet we’ve seen little publicity to promote it since its arrival in April.”
